Mahal na Pangulong Aquino:
Kamakailan lamang ako nakakuha ng kopya ng liham ni G. Jose Laderas Santos sa Punong Mahistrado Kgg. Renato C. Corona, may petsang 27 Enero 2011, at humihiling na ilisin ang TRO na ipinataw ng Korte Suprema laban sa pitong National Artist na nais iproklama ng dating Pangulong Gloria Macapagal-Arroyo noong 2009. Malaki ang aking pasasalamat at hindi sinunod ng Kataas-taasang Hukuman ang hiling ni G. Santos.
Gayunman, isang magandang pagkakataon ito upang kondenahin ang patuloy na pamumunò ni G. Santos bilang Punong Komisyoner ng Komisyon sa Wikang Filipino (KWF) at bilang Acting Chair ng Board of Commissioners, National Commission for Culture and the Arts (NCCA), mga titulong ginamit niya sa kaniyang liham upang marahil ay “magulat” ang Punong Mahistrado sa kaniyang kalipikasyon. Kailangan ninyong malaman, Mahal na Pangulo, na ginawa ito ni G. Santos nang hindi sinasangguni ang mga board ng KWF at NCCA at isang malinaw na pagsasamantala at abuso sa kaniyang mga opisyal na tungkulin. Malinaw din sa kaniyang kilos ang pagsunod sa kapritso ng kaniyang mga dating patron na sina Gng. Cecile Guidote Alvarez at G. Carlo Caparas, na pinagkakautangan niya ng kaniyang appointment bilang Punong Komisyoner ng KWF sa isang bandá at makikinabang bilang mga DNA (Dagdag National Artist) kapag inalis ang TRO sa kabilang bandá.
Sa kaniyang liham, tahasang sinasalungat ni G. Santos ang paninindigang moral para sa “daang matuwid” ng mga National Artist at mga manunulat at alagad ng sining sa buong bansa na nagrali at humiling sa Korte Suprema noong 2009 para pigilin ang “nilutong” proklamasyon ni dating pangulong Gloria Macapagal-Arroyo. Sa kaniyang liham din ay nakatanghal ang karumal-dumal na katauhan ni G. Santos at isang katwiran upang patalsikin siya sa NCCA at KWF. Hindi siya karapat-dapat mamunò sa kahit aling ahensiya ng bayan. Hindi siya karapat-dapat pagtiwalaan ng mga alagad ng wika at alagad ng kultura ng Filipinas.
Ang kaniyang liham, sa kabilâng dako, ay isa ring magandang pakakataon upang ibaling ninyo ang pansin hinggil sa ganitong problema sa sektor ng kultura sa ating bansa. Bukod sa paglilinis sa mga ahensiyang pangkultura na sinaksakan ng mga kampon ni Gng. Arroyo, tulad ni G. Santos, kailangan ang inyong malinaw na patnubay sa dapat maging papel ng mga naturang ahensiya sa inyong programang pambansa. Sa kaso halimbawa ng mga bagong National Artist, marahil, kailangang atasan na ninyo ang bagong pamunuan ng NCCA at CCP upang repasuhin ang mga kandidato noong 2009 at muling irekomenda sa inyo ang tunay na karapat-dapat maging mga bagong National Artist. Napakainam din po kung bibigyan ninyo ng sapat na panahon ang kulturang pambansa, lalo na dahil ang tinutunggali ninyong korupsiyon ay isang pamanang pangkultura ng nakaraang panahon at malaki ang maitutulong sa inyo ng isang mahusay na kampanyang pangkultura sa pagbuo ng “daang matuwid.”
Marami pong salamat sa inyong panahong basahin ito.
Gumagalang at umaasa,
VIRGILIO S. ALMARIO
Pambansang Alagad ng Sining sa Panitikan

Goodbye, Manong Pepe
The vaunted carinderia of Jollibee is now closed. And abruptly at that:
What went wrong? Servings are miniscule for the price. There's also needless paper bowls, tarpaulins, sintras, and other expensive packaging and marketing that ups the price, without bringing greater quality to the food.
Probably wrongly plotted niche to target, or not fully laid-out business model. And Jollibee needs someone who really understand the target class before this chain is reopened.

- Yvonne Elliman should stop doing concerts. She sounds like my alcoholic grandmother. She can't reach the notes required in I dont know how to love him, and just shames herself. In the middle of the song, she had to stop the band, and ask that they lower the pitch.
- She shared an interesting story though on how she just needs to substitute in a band one night, and then got cast as Mary Magdalene in Jesus Christ Superstar the following day.
- All three singers are lowering the pitch of their songs to be able to reach it.
- Some uncalled for attack on Stephen Bishop's physical appearance: he apparently ballooned to overweight fat over the recent years, but his legs and arms are thin out of proportion. He walks slowly minding the literal huge weight he had to carry. Also, Bishop sounds like Jonah Hill when speaking. And I think the reason he is keeping a full beard is because his upper lip is too thin.
- But Bish's voice is still there! Still can melt hearts. I wonder how he sounds on a smaller venue. They had another show at Casino Filipino the following week, cant find one review at this time.
- I didnt know Dan Hill was grandfather old, but the voice and distinct style are still there. All of Dan Hills song have fantastic first lines, like horses bursting out of the gates.
